Payroll & Benefits Coordinator
About the role
We are seeking a Payroll & Benefits Coordinator to support on-time payroll processing and effective benefits administration. The ideal candidate will have 1-2 years of experience in payroll processing and benefits administration, hands-on experience in ADP or comparable HRIS, familiarity with employment laws, leave regulations, and benefits compliance, proficiency in Excel / Google Sheets, excellent attention to detail, organization, and follow-through, strong communication and customer service skills, and ability to handle confidential data professionally and with discretion.
Responsibilities
- Prepare semi-monthly payroll for exempt and non-exempt employees, ensuring accuracy and timeliness
- Review and reconcile timesheets, PTO balances, and payroll data inputs prior to each pay run
- Process payroll adjustments including new hires, terminations, pay changes, garnishments, and voluntary deductions
- Support preparation of year-end payroll activities including W-2 distribution and reconciliation
- Respond to employee inquiries about pay, deductions, and paycheck reconciliation in a timely and professional manner
- Administer employee benefits programs including health, dental, vision, life insurance, 401(k), FSA/HSA, and wellness offerings
- Coordinate open enrollment periods — prepare communications, host informational sessions, and guide employees through elections
- Process enrollments, qualifying life event changes, and terminations with insurance carriers and benefit platforms
- Reconcile monthly benefit invoices and coordinate with Finance to ensure accurate payroll deductions
- Serve as a key resource to our employees, efficiently and effectively answering any payroll and benefits questions on a timely basis
- Maintain accurate and confidential employee records in the HRIS and payroll system
- Aid in compliance filings and reporting, including ACA, COBRA, ERISA, and state/local requirements
- Support audits of payroll and benefits data to ensure data integrity
- Monitor and track FMLA and leave of absence documentation in partnership with the HR team
- Partner with HR Business Partners, Finance, and People Operations on projects and process improvements
- Assist with onboarding new hires by conducting benefits orientations and ensuring timely enrollment
- Generate standard and ad hoc payroll and benefits reports for internal stakeholders
